500 _aThere is a core of enzyme kinetics that every biochemist needs to be familiar with, and every biochemistry student needs to be taught. This textbook presents that core in a logical and helpful manner and links traditional ideas on enzyme kinetics with the latest theories about enzyme mechanisms. It also discusses the possible implications of protein engineering. Students will find this book an invaluable aid in a notoriously difficult subject.
